Who were the Nephilim of Gen. 6:1-4

and who are the sons of god?

The sons of god?

There are a lot of stories and fables concerning the passage in Genesis 6:1-4. We have all heard of those who believe that the sons of "god" (Gen. 6:2) were fallen messages (angels), who kept not their first estate, and had relations with the daughters of men resulting in some super-human corrupted being. These fables make good stories, but that is all they are, stories. The truth lies in Scripture, but requires a correct analysis of the applicable passage involved (exegesis), and not relying on the fables, or stories promoted by men.

Some others hold, since angels are sexless, (without the need or ability to procreate) the words "took them wives" must signify some kind of a lasting marriage, and that the reference must have to do with the break down and the separation of the godly line of Seth from the un-godly line of Cain. A refinement of this last view would hold that the expression "sons of god" would refer to the godly folks, while "daughters of men" refers to the un-godly. It is our position at the Assembly of Yahweh, Cascade, that both these views are false.

What we do know from other scriptures, is, that "celestial" messengers (angels) are indeed sexless beings. Yahshua indicated such in Matt. 22:30, and in Mk 12:25. Messengers of Yahweh are NOT given in marriage; they are ministering entities that can become visible and be seen in the "semblance" of the human form, (Gen. 19:1). They always have a masculine gender, and they can have access to inconceivable power (2 Kings 19:35), power given to them only by Yahweh for His purpose. Their primary place is about the throne of Yahweh, (Rev. 5:11; 7:11).

We must also understand that Yahweh is always in complete control of all His creation, and His messengers (they were created to serve Him). He (Yahweh) says, "My counsel does stand, and all My delight I do" (Isa.46: 10)..... also "I have created the waster to destroy" (Isa.54: 16)....and also, He is... "working all matters according to the counsel of His desire," (Eph.1: 11).

Footnotes:

1). Heb. 'adamah' (with the article), from which the term the "Adamic-man" is derived. Without the article, this would be the proper name of the first man ('Adam) of the adamic race of people.

2). Heb. 'Alueim' is a plural noun, but often functions as a collective singular, taking a singular verb. It is related to the Hebrew terms: 'Aloah and 'Al, meaning - the powerful one(s), or the mighty one(s) (with the article, a description), or mighty-one(s), (without the article, a title). It can refer to judge(s), leader(s), ruler(s), celestial beings, gods of nations, or to the One Creator of Israel. Here with the article we translate it as 'the mighty-ones' (those who are distinguished from out of the common population,) possibly of the various pre-adamic races of people on the earth at that time.

3). --------- This 'line' Indicates and reproduces, the location of an important textual and/or context divisions in the ancient Hebrew manuscripts.

4). Heb. 'ruach' lit "wind" to translate this word "spirit" is conjecture. Yahweh is not wind, but “a life Essence .”

5). In the sense of 'judge,' or possibly "abide."

6). or possibly "in that he is also flesh" (meaning is uncertain).

7). The meaning is uncertain, as the root verb is unclear; possibly "cast-down, or fallen ones" (during battle), "miscarried ones," "distinguished ones," "wonderful ones," or "mighty ones, strong ones (of the ruling class, not for intelligence, but because of their ability to over-power others)," used only here and Num. 13:33. This Heb. word does not translate "giant," and to do so is conjecture. Content in Num. 13:33 may indicate that these 'sons of Anaq' may also have been a race with large size and stature.

8). Heb. 'powerful' as in warrior, or possibly as a "tyrant, or trouble maker."

9). Heb. Lit "from an age" 'concealed' possibly "a time out of mind" (in the past or in the future).

10). Heb. 'ish in the plural. Ancient man-kind-like, used with great latitude, lacking the nature of the adamic-man, more in the nature of the Neandertal.

11). Heb. 'name' with the idea of an appellation, a distinctive well known, or famous position (from their attitude to others).
